BM Messenger 254 (P107133)
Administrative tag excavated in Girsu (mod. Tello), dated to the Ur III (ca. 2100-2000 BC) period and now kept in British Museum, London, UKMetadata / catalogue

object tag
obverse
1. pisan-dub-ba
en: Basket-of-tablets:
2. nig2-ka9-ak
en: accounts
3. lu2 nig2-dab5
en: men of nigdab
4. ugnim-ke4-ne
en: of Ugnim,
reverse
1. mu ki-masz{ki}
en: year: “Kimaš.”
